Hey everyone,

I’ve noticed a few posts about this already, but I think it’s worth repeating. Recently, a new attack tactic has surfaced where malicious actors create GitHub repos using a developer’s name and the name of a well-known Mac app.

In my case, someone created a repo under my full name, claiming to offer one of my apps (Dory - App Switcher) for free. I couldn’t fully investigate the script they shared, but it’s safe to assume it wasn’t anything good. Thankfully, GitHub removed it within 30 minutes of my report - and I know other developers also flagged the user, which definitely helped.

A few reminders:

* Don’t trust repos with fewer than 100 stars that offer “free” versions of paid apps.

* Never run scripts or pkg files from sources you don’t fully trust.

* If you’re not a power user, the App Store remains the safest option.

Greetings sub! Introducing my completed 2013 Mac Pro with an Asus EeePC netbook swapped inside. This started out life as an old silly project involving the EeePC and a security camera DVR that I shoved together when I was a teenager. Since then it has been shockingly reliable, but it's not show friendly due to the nature if how the DVR box is held together. When the shell of this Mac Pro came across my desk, I saved it from eWaste to rehouse this netbook into it.

What followed was a surprisingly difficult time getting everything to fit and mount nicely. The motherboard had to be clocked at a weird angle so all of the port extensions could fit around the weird dome shapes, the ports on the back had to be recessed for the cover to slide over it, and even the PSU had to be nervously shaved down to clear the round cover.

Specs:

CPU: Intel Atom N270

RAM: 1 x 2GB DDR2 (maxed out)

Drive: 128GB SSD

OS: HaikuOS (spiritual successor to BeOS)

Discussion Why are MacOS screenshots so huge?

Post image
64 Upvotes

I take screenshots pretty often so I'm trying to make them a smaller size. Found a terminal command that sets the default as jpg instead of png but the effect is marginal. Then I found that quick actions>convert image with the "actual size" preset decreases the size by A LOT while being the same resolution and jpg format. As you can see here, it took this one from 4.9mb to 1.5mb

Is there any way to make default screenshots this compressed? or a way to automate this with the shortcuts app? Why are the original screenshots so bloated anyways?
